Hey - just wondering if anyone knows the answer to this.

I have a squillion rex2 files which aren't that much use to me if I'm working on the Linux platform. But I'm guessing all you have to do is load up a rex2 file and then save it as an XTC clip - and then it can be transferred to XT2Linux and work pretty much like a rex2 file except in native Linux?

I haven't got XT2 Windows set-up at the moment so can't try it myself.
